Output 66b588d6a6aaba7ae711939433baeb884d8faeba8c830952eb06cec1c6d84169:23
- value
- 59950
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eb33f0456640a08f67016371cc2d01312965dec8 OP_EQUAL
- address
- 3P8ewNtfcXujMeC4ZznDXDeMtabLqvmZKp
- transaction
- 66b588d6a6aaba7ae711939433baeb884d8faeba8c830952eb06cec1c6d84169
- confirmations
- 270383
- spent
- true